Motorola announces moto e22i with Dolby Atmos sound heading to Australia under $200

Motorola has something special for their next budget friendly handset with the moto e22i offering a ‘multisensory experience’ thanks to the inclusion of Dolby Atmos enabled stereo sound. 

The moto e22i is available from today with the handset priced at $179, it will also arrive on the Vodafone network November 16th. Motorola says that the moto e22i will offer up to 25 per cent more powerful sound than the previous generation moto e, which should make it a great sounding device. 

The moto e22i isn’t just about audio, with a large 6.5” HD+ resolution display with a 90Hz refresh rate offering fluid, responsive scrolling throughout the phone. The moto e22i also includes a 16MP AI camera system which includes a 2MP depth sensor, and a 5MP selfie camera on the front..

Powered by a MediaTek Helio G37 processor with 2GB RAM and 32GB of storage which can be expanded up to 1Tb with microSD cards, the moto e22i runs Android 12 (Go edition) for lower specced devices. The Android (Go edition) OS comes with a range of Go Edition apps including Google Go, Maps, Go and more, offering a fast and responsive experience from the apps.

Motorola will be bringing the moto e22i to Australia in two colour options: Graphite Gray and Winter White.

You’ll be able to get hands on today at JB Hi-Fi, Officeworks, Big W, The Good Guys and Mobileciti as well as from Motorola through their Lenovo.com.au store or at Vodafone from November 16th.
